Introduction The 558 Multi Channel Power Amplifier provides five discrete power amplifiers in a single enclosure, and is ideal for multi-channel surround systems. Two pairs of channels can also be operated in bridge mode, for over twice the power output. The 558 Multi Channel Power Amplifier uses a unique feedback topology and precision local error correction system. It includes two massive twin wound toroidal transformers, and the unit has full thermal, load, and DC protection on every output.

Specification and accessories Specification Available accessories Input 1.4V RMS. Output (bridged Greater than 200W per channel into 8Ω. mode off) Greater than 300W per channel into 4Ω. Output (bridged Greater than 400W into 8Ω. mode on) Greater than 600W into 4Ω. Distortion Less than 0.05%. Noise Less than -90dB. Trigger input 5 to 30Vdc or 5-30Vac peak to peak, polarity independent. Finish Black textured enamel and brushed aluminium.

Standby Once set up, the multi channel power amplifier can be left in standby as it consumes negligible power in this mode. To bring the amplifier out of standby press the button on the automatically using the TRIGGER INPUT; see below. If you are not going to use the multi channel power amplifier for a period of several days you should switch the unit completely off, at the back panel, and disconnect it from the AC power supply.
